One of the most important loads which can decisively affect the resistance capacity of casing, tubing, and submarine pipelines is the external pressure, causing the pipe collapse phenomenon (especially in high pressure wells and when installing deep water sea lines). This paper presents the results of research activities aimed at investigating the external pressure collapse phenomenon for perfectly circular tubes, in order to define design methodologies and criteria for assessing the external pressure resistance capacity of oil industry tubulars. For this purpose tests were performed on small scale pipe specimens, based on the similitude law, and their results were compared with the calculation formulas usually used to assess pipe collapse resistance capacity.
